AI Revolutionizing Sports Scouting
In older days, scouting was all about watching endless footage of the game, using a gut feeling, and making decisions subjectively. Things have changed. AI technologies now analyze thousands of games around the globe to catalog speed, accuracy, decision-making, and even mental toughness.
ShotTracker, for example, is an AI-based tool that tracks every dribble, pass, and shot during a basketball game with 99% accuracy. The Miami Heat leverages AI to forecast the shooting efficiency of players relative to the arcs of their shots. In football, Liverpool is known to use AI-powered scouting software that analyzes passing vision, stamina, and even nuanced acceleration patterns to find talent like Darwin Núñez long before they become popular. Predicting Future Stars with AI
Can you imagine if AI could tell you which upcoming 16-year-olds are going to be the next LeBron James or Erling Haaland? It isn't speculation anymore—it's happening right now.
Next Gen Stats of the NBA used machine learning to evaluate the skill sets of upcoming players and compare them to their older counterparts. Dončić had statistically an 85% similarity with past MVP guards, and Next Gen Stats calculated it even before he was on an NBA court. In football, SciSports tracks over 90,000 players worldwide and forecasts which young talents will peak as stars and when.
An AI program estimated the chances of a 15-year-old Brazilian prodigy, Endrick, making it to Europe’s elite leagues at 78% before the age of 18. Real Madrid didn't take long to sign him, even before he had made a professional debut. The takeaway is that AI wasn't taking scouting jobs but rather making it more efficient.

Machine Learning in Player Evaluation
AI comprehends more than just skills—it analyzes what a player can potentially become. Based on historical data, machine learning models project when a player is most valuable and their level of output.
For instance, based on AI algorithms, players who possess high levels of stamina at age seventeen are 63% more likely to be professional athletes after the age of thirty. Clubs such as Bayern Munich utilize AI to monitor the heat maps of young midfielders, trying to replicate the movements of elite playmakers like Xavi or Modrić.
This is not mere speculation. Brentford FC, a Premier League club, built their whole recruitment strategy on AI scouting to identify underappreciated players and transform them into stars. With AI, teams are able to identify talent before their market value shoots up, providing a competitive advantage.
Injury Risk Assessment with AI
A player’s worst nightmare? Injuries. But what if AI could intervene long before that with preventative measures?
AI predicts injury risks with unbelievable accuracy. According to a study in the EPL, AI models successfully predicted 72% of hamstring injuries with movement tracking. Clubs like AC Milan use AI-powered wearables to monitor fatigue and reduce soft-tissue injuries by 40%.
Basketball teams use AI with the Golden State Warriors to mitigate overuse injuries by monitoring player load and adjusting time on the court. AI monitoring systems also prevented Derrick Rose from a second ACL tear by identifying painful muscle imbalances prior to injury.
